Importing Your Pet to Pakistan

Moderate to import
Regulations checked

Pakistan runs pet imports through one digital gate: the import permit, required in advance for every dog and cat, filed on the Pakistan Single Window portal under the Animal Quarantine Department (AQD) of the Ministry of National Food Security and Research. With the permit issued, the rest is a short list: a 15-digit ISO microchip, a rabies vaccination between 30 days and 12 months old, and a health certificate signed within 7 days of entry and endorsed by the origin government’s vets.

There is no titre test from any country and no quarantine for compliant pets. The AQD inspects arrivals at Karachi (Jinnah International), Islamabad International and Lahore (Allama Iqbal International) and releases healthy, documented animals. Because permit processing time is not published, file the application as soon as travel dates firm up.

Import Requirements

Microchip

Required (15-digit ISO 11784).

Rabies Vaccination

Required, between 30 days and 12 months before entry.

Titre Test

Not required from any country.

Quarantine

No quarantine for compliant pets. The Animal Quarantine Department inspects on arrival and handles non-compliant animals at its discretion.

Import Permit

Required in advance for every dog and cat, issued by the Animal Quarantine Department under the Ministry of National Food Security and Research, applied for through the Pakistan Single Window portal (psw.gov.pk/aqd).

Health Certificate

Required, completed by a licensed vet within 7 days of entry and endorsed by the origin country's government veterinary authority.

Breed Restrictions

No published national banned-breed list. Airline rules (notably Emirates' brachycephalic restrictions) bite harder in practice.

The permit, and the order of operations

Apply on the Single Window (psw.gov.pk/aqd) before anything else, because downstream steps depend on the permit. Owners moving from the Gulf discover this quickly: the UAE’s MOCCAE export certificate application, for example, asks for a copy of the destination import permit, so the Pakistani document must exist first.

The health certificate belongs to the final week: issued by a licensed vet within 7 days of entry and government-endorsed. Match the certificate details to the microchip and permit exactly.

Getting a flight that takes pets

The corridor realities vary sharply by carrier, especially from the Gulf, Pakistan’s densest pet route. Emirates carries no cats or dogs in the cabin, offering checked-baggage carriage on shorter sectors at flat weight-tier fees and SkyCargo otherwise, with snub-nosed breeds accepted only in winter. Etihad currently allows cabin pets up to 8kg including carrier. flydubai is cargo-only. PIA accepts crated animals in the hold as excess baggage with the permit and certificate in hand.

Summer matters: Gulf heat embargoes from May to September restrict hold and cargo carriage, so winter bookings or early-morning departures clear more easily.
